BF13 MDN is a 2013 Chevrolet Orlando in Red with a 1,998c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 6 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 50%.
Across all 2013 Chevrolet Orlando models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.4% with a typical mileage of 60,144 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Chevrolet Orlando fails its MOT is coil spring broken, accounting for 1,069 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BF13 MDN,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Chevrolet Orlando typically stays on UK roads for around 15 years. At 13 years old, this Chevrolet Orlando is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
